tretret
Ведем учет пользователей: от таблицы до аудита
Хранить пользователей в БД — это не просто привычка, а часть архитектуры. Централизованный учет помогает: Покажу, как грамотно реализовать это на Oracle SQL с проверкой, обработкой ошибок и аудитом. CREATE TABLE users ( USERID NUMBER GENERATED ALWAYS AS IDENTITY PRIMARY KEY, LOGIN VARCHAR2(100) NOT NULL UNIQUE, CREATED_AT DATE DEFAULT SYSDATE, CONSTRAINT login_min_length CHECK (LENGTH(login) >= 3) ); CREATE OR REPLACE FUNCTION f_get_user_id(p_login IN VARCHAR2)
RETURN NUMBER IS
v_user_id ...
Скачивание и установка ORACLE XE
Здравствуйте, друзья! Наверняка вы уже знаете, что с недавнего времени начали возникать проблемы при скачивании ORACLE с официального сайта. Похоже, ORACLE, как и многие зарубежные компании, поддержала санкции против Российской Федерации и начала блокировать скачивание её продуктов из России. Использование ORACLE в некоммерческих целях не требует приобретение лицензии. Можно было несложно скачать ORACLE с официального сайта, установить её себе на домашний компьютер или ноутбук и учиться. Теперь загрузить стало сложнее...